lying to the SE. of Hokkaid yesterday. having moved Northwards and approached the neighbourhood of that station.
The: barometer, has fallen moderately over China and risen alightly over B.W Japan and the Honius.MOVER, A
Probably a depression is approaching N. China from the Westward,
The highest pressure is now shown over the Lower Tangise Valley.
Fresh to moderate monsoon is indicated over the China Hon
Hongkong rainfall for the 24 hours ending at 10a.m.-to-day, 0.01 incher.
